Topics - pre-dawn raids across Sydney may have thwarted a plot by an Islamist terror cell to kidnap and behead a random member of the public. One man's been charged with serious terrorism-related offences and another 14 detained. Something was thought to be up after Australia's outgoing spy chief, ASIO director David Irvine, raised the terror alert level to "high" last week.The Commodore is in, in Fiji. Frank Bainimarama's Fiji First Party has 60 percent of the vote at last count, five times ahead of his nearest rival.
